Players Discover a 50-hit hidden wall: There are a lot of secrets to find in the vast world of Elden Ring. But many of those secrets hidden by fake walls. Illusory walls, for the uninitiated, are secret passageways that look like solid walls.

They make to look like walls. If you hit one of these walls with a melee attack. It will fall and you can go through and see what’s on the other side.

That’s not all, though. Players of the game Elden Ring have now found a hidden wall in the game that takes more than one hit to open.

Some people on Reddit posted a clip of this solid Elden Ring illusory wall. A player character named Elden Ring smacks the wall repeatedly in the clip. Finally, the wall reveals the hidden room on the other side.

A small dining room area with NPCs that players can quickly get to by other means is at the end of the path. Fans may wonder if there are other walls in Elden Ring‘s world that they can find. This raises the question, though.

Many fans of the Elden Ring are surprised by this because it opens the door to the possibility that other walls need a lot of hits to open. It also means that the Elden Ring troll messages that made people attack walls for no reason may not have been lying.

Some of those walls might have opened if people had taken the time to hit them more.
This wall can only be seen by going to Volcano Manor, which is an area that most people who play Elden Ring won’t get to until they’re already a long way into the game.
